How long: You will realize the sedating properties of the med the first night; however, the antidepressant properties will probably not be felt for 2 to 4 weeks. If you are anxious, these properties generally not felt for 4 to 6 weeks, but could be sooner. An important thing to remember with this med is the lower the dose, the more sedating it is. 2 - 4 weeks: Like most other antidepressants, Mirtazapine (brand name remeron) usually starts to result in improvement after about 2 weeks of use, with increasing benefit over the next several weeks. In my own practice, i tend not to wait much past 4 weeks if there's been no benefit at all; other psychiatrists will say to wait up to 6 or 8 weeks.
